Pictus PhD Fellowship Programme
Czech Technical University in Prague – International PhD Programme (PICTUS) will recruit a total of 23 PhD students (see Eligibility criteria below) for a full 48-month employment contract and enroll them in a specific PhD course. Candidates should prepare their own research proposal from the topics offered .

Liquid Phase Chemistry of Homologues of Superheavy Elements
Description:
A new joint CTU – University of Oslo – Nuclear Physics Institute ASCR Super Heavy Elements (SHE) homologues laboratory was set-up at the U-120M cyclotron beamline in Řež (Czechia) in 2017/2018. The main focus of the new lab is on the chemistry of SHE homologues and on building an on-line versatile fast low-flow aqueous chemistry apparatus. Main attention is paid to the study of redox behaviour of homologues for element Sg (Z=106) (Mo, W), Nh (Z=113) (Tl, In), and selected lanthanoids as models for the transfermium actinoids Md, No and Lr. The topic of the proposed doctoral research will focus on liquid phase chemistry of these elements and on development of a system where electrochemistry will be combined with liquid-liquid extraction and flow radiation detection.
Secondment opportunities
University of Oslo, Department of Nuclear Chemistry, 3-4 months, research and training in on-line liquid phase chemistry systems. Co-supervisor: prof. Jon Petter Omtvedt

Benefits and Conditions
Gross monthly salary of 69 300 CZK/month*
Family allowance 8 888 CZK/month (for applicants with dependent family members)
Travel support for conferences and secondments
Research costs1
*The gross monthly salary CZK is under the standard scheme in the Czech Republic and includes mandatory social and health insurance. Therefore, the gross salary contains an employee contribution to social and health insurance of 11% and it is standardly taxable (15 % rate). Some tax discounts are given to e.g. employees with children. All rates subject to adjustments due to changing exchange rate.
Example: a single researcher would get approx. 55 000 CZK as net salary
The offered salary is equivalent to the standard MSCA individual postdoc award, and it is highly competitive
